What are the key material differences between Silicone and Polyurethane (PU) moulds for veneer stone?
Choosing the right material is critical for production efficiency. Silicone moulds offer superior flexibility and natural release properties, making them ideal for intricate textures and deep undercuts without the need for heavy release agents. However, Polyurethane (PU) moulds are more durable for high-volume industrial use, offering higher abrasion resistance and a longer lifespan when casting abrasive concrete or cement mixes. For B2B buyers, PU is generally more cost-effective for mass production, while silicone is preferred for high-end architectural replicas.
How do I evaluate the technical specifications for industrial-grade brick moulds?
Buyers should focus on the Shore A Hardness rating; typically, a range of 40-60 Shore A is ideal for balancing ease of demoulding with structural integrity. Ensure the mould has reinforced ribbing on the exterior to prevent deformation under the weight of wet concrete. Additionally, verify the UV resistance and thermal stability of the material, especially if the production facility is not climate-controlled, to prevent the moulds from becoming brittle or warping over time.
What compliance standards and quality certifications should I request from suppliers?
To ensure safety and quality, prioritize suppliers who hold ISO 9001:2015 certification for quality management systems. For the materials themselves, request REACH or RoHS compliance reports to ensure the moulds do not contain harmful phthalates or heavy metals, which is particularly important for entry into EU and North American markets. If you are sourcing for a large-scale construction project, ask for tensile strength and tear strength test reports to validate the manufacturer's durability claims.
How can I ensure the aesthetic authenticity of the stone veneer produced?
The quality of the 'master stone' used to create the mould determines the final look. Professional suppliers on Made-in-China.com often use 3D scanning technology or handcrafted masters from real natural stones. Request high-resolution photos of the texture details and ask about the pattern repetition rate; a high-quality set should include at least 5 to 10 unique mould patterns to avoid a repetitive, artificial appearance on large wall surfaces.

What are the primary risks when importing veneer moulds and how can they be mitigated?
The biggest risk is material substitution, where a supplier uses low-grade recycled plastic instead of virgin PU or silicone. To mitigate this, request a pre-shipment sample and utilize third-party inspection services (like SGS or Intertek) to verify the material density and flexibility before the final balance is paid. How should I negotiate pricing and MOQs for custom mould designs?
Custom designs involve tooling costs (mould making fees). Negotiate a rebate program where the initial tooling fee is refunded once your cumulative order volume reaches a certain threshold (e.g., 500+ units). For standard designs, leverage volume-based pricing; increasing your order from 50 to 200 units can often reduce the unit price by 15-25% due to the efficiencies in chemical mixing and pouring cycles.
What are the best practices for international shipping and logistics for these products?
Veneer moulds are relatively heavy and bulky. For cost-efficiency, Sea Freight (LCL or FCL) is the standard choice. Ensure the supplier uses fumigated wooden crates or heavy-duty palletizing to prevent the bottom moulds from being crushed during transit. Clearly define Incoterms (e.g., FOB or CIF) in the contract; for first-time buyers, CIF (Cost, Insurance, and Freight) is often easier as the seller handles the logistics to your nearest port.
How do I handle customs duties and trade policy alignment?
Check the HS Code (typically under Chapter 39 for plastics/rubbers or 84 for machinery moulds) to determine the specific import tariffs in your country. Be aware of anti-dumping duties that may apply to certain plastic products in specific regions. Ensure the supplier provides a Certificate of Origin (CO), which may allow you to benefit from Preferential Trade Agreements and significantly reduce your import tax burden.
